Mattia De Sciglio is back in the Milan squad against Sassuolo tomorrow after his badly sprained ankle.

It kicks off on Sunday at 14.00 GMT, click here for a match preview.

The Rossoneri are still without injured Luca Antonelli, Riccardo Montolivo, Jack Bonaventura and Alessio Romagnoli.

De Sciglio has been out of action since a crunching Rodrigo De Paul tackle sprained his ankle on January 29, a 2-1 defeat to Udinese.

There were fears he’d be sidelined for the rest of the season, but fortunately avoided a fracture or ligament damage.

Vincenzo Montella noted Gianluca Lapadula returned from the Italy training camp with a swollen ankle, but he too is in the squad.

Milan squad for Sassuolo: Donnarumma, Plizzari, Storari; Abate, Calabria, De Sciglio, Gomez, Paletta, Vangioni, Zapata; Bertolacci, Mati Fernandez, Honda, Kucka, Locatelli, Pasalic, Poli, Sosa; Bacca, Deulofeu, Lapadula, Ocampos, Suso
